27 /// \brief LLVM Argument representation
28 ///
29 /// This class represents an incoming formal argument to a Function. A formal
30 /// argument, since it is ``formal'', does not contain an actual value but
31 /// instead represents the type, argument number, and attributes of an argument
32 /// for a specific function. When used in the body of said function, the
33 /// argument of course represents the value of the actual argument that the
34 /// function was called with.
35 class Argument : public Value, public ilist_node<Argument> {
36   virtual void anchor();
37   Function *Parent;
38 
39   friend class SymbolTableListTraits<Argument, Function>;
40   void setParent(Function *parent);
41 
42 public:
43   /// \brief Constructor.
44   ///
45   /// If \p F is specified, the argument is inserted at the end of the argument
46   /// list for \p F.
47   explicit Argument(Type *Ty, const Twine &Name = "", Function *F = nullptr);
48 
getParent()49   inline const Function *getParent() const { return Parent; }
getParent()50   inline       Function *getParent()       { return Parent; }
51 
52   /// \brief Return the index of this formal argument in its containing
53   /// function.
54   ///
55   /// For example in "void foo(int a, float b)" a is 0 and b is 1.
56   unsigned getArgNo() const;
57 
58   /// \brief Return true if this argument has the nonnull attribute on it in
59   /// its containing function.
60   bool hasNonNullAttr() const;
61 
62   /// \brief Return true if this argument has the byval attribute on it in its
63   /// containing function.
64   bool hasByValAttr() const;
65 
66   /// \brief Return true if this argument has the byval attribute or inalloca
67   /// attribute on it in its containing function.  These attributes both
68   /// represent arguments being passed by value.
69   bool hasByValOrInAllocaAttr() const;
70 
71   /// \brief If this is a byval or inalloca argument, return its alignment.
72   unsigned getParamAlignment() const;
73 
74   /// \brief Return true if this argument has the nest attribute on it in its
75   /// containing function.
76   bool hasNestAttr() const;
77 
78   /// \brief Return true if this argument has the noalias attribute on it in its
79   /// containing function.
80   bool hasNoAliasAttr() const;
81 
82   /// \brief Return true if this argument has the nocapture attribute on it in
83   /// its containing function.
84   bool hasNoCaptureAttr() const;
85 
86   /// \brief Return true if this argument has the sret attribute on it in its
87   /// containing function.
88   bool hasStructRetAttr() const;
89 
90   /// \brief Return true if this argument has the returned attribute on it in
91   /// its containing function.
92   bool hasReturnedAttr() const;
93 
94   /// \brief Return true if this argument has the readonly or readnone attribute
95   /// on it in its containing function.
96   bool onlyReadsMemory() const;
97 
98   /// \brief Return true if this argument has the inalloca attribute on it in
99   /// its containing function.
100   bool hasInAllocaAttr() const;
101 
102   /// \brief Add a Attribute to an argument.
103   void addAttr(AttributeSet AS);
104 
105   /// \brief Remove a Attribute from an argument.
106   void removeAttr(AttributeSet AS);
107 
108   /// \brief Method for support type inquiry through isa, cast, and
109   /// dyn_cast.
classof(const Value * V)110   static inline bool classof(const Value *V) {
111     return V->getValueID() == ArgumentVal;
112   }
113 };
